Write an equation for each translation of y = |x|.

15.5 units left

A. y = | x | – 15.5

B. y = | x + 15.5 |

C. y = | x – 15.5 |

D. y = | x | + 15.5

Answer:

B. y = | x + 15.5 |

Explanation:

Given : y= |x|.

To find : Write an equation for each translation of y= |x|. 15.5 units left .

Solution : We have given that y= |x|.

By the translation rule :if function transformed to f(x ) →→→ f(x +h) Then graph of the function would shift h units left.

For translation 15.5 unit left we need to add 15.5 in function y= |x|.

y = | x + 15.5 |

Therefore, y = | x + 15.5 |.
